Sarkari Exam after 10th
- Staff Selection Commission (SSC) Multi Tasking Staff (MTS) Examination
- SSC Matriculation Level Combined Higher Secondary Level (CHSL) Examination
-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) Group D Examination
- Indian Army Soldier Recruitment
- Indian Navy Sailor Recruitment
- Indian Air Force Airmen Recruitment
-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) Constable Recruitment
- Border Security Force (BSF) Constable Recruitment
- Central Industrial Security Force (CISF) Constable Recruitment
- Assam Rifles Constable Recruitment
- Postman Recruitment
- Group C and D Posts in Government Departments and PSUs

Benefits
- Job security: Sarkari jobs for 10th and 12th are known for their sarkari jobs for 10th and 12th security. Once you are appointed to a Sarkari job, you are likely to remain employed until retirement, as long as you perform your job duties satisfactorily.
- Good salary and benefits: Sarkari jobs for 10th and 12th typically offer good salaries and benefits, such as health insurance, pension plans, and paid leave.
- Opportunities for advancement: There are many opportunities for advancement in Sarkari jobs. If you perform well in your job, you may be promoted to higher positions with better salaries and benefits.
- Respect and social status: Sarkari jobs for 10th and 12th are highly respected in India. Sarkari employees are often seen as being more educated and qualified than people in the private sector.
- Work-life balance: Sarkari jobs for 10th and 12th typically offer good work-life balance. Sarkari employees typically have regular working hours and are entitled to paid leave, which allows them to spend time with their families and pursue hobbies.
